• 博客园首秀----Markdown


        以前听说过Markdown但不知道是干什么的,以及怎么用,还想着到时候要是想写博客,怎么写呢?难道要HTML一个一个往上敲,然后第一次编辑博客的时候,发现有个Markdown编辑器,就去了解了一下,最后就惊呆了,这也太好用了吧!所以决定把博客园的首秀给Markdown吧!一来是好好学习一下Markdown,好写出漂亮的博客,虽说博客更注重的是文章的质量,但颜值也是不可或缺的,二来是熟悉熟悉博客园的发博流程。

        Markdown是一种轻量级标记语言,允许人们使用易读易写的纯文本格式编写文档,然后转换成格式丰富的HTML页面,Markdown文件的后缀是".md"


    功能演示: `灰色框内是使用方法` 这里呈现效果


    标题

    示例:
    # 标题一
    ## 标题二
    ### 标题三
    #### 标题四
    ##### 标题五
    ###### 标题六

    效果:

    标题一

    标题二

    标题三

    标题四

    标题五
    标题六


    字符效果

    ~~删除线~~ 或者 <s>HTML标签里的删除线</s>
    删除线


    *斜体字* 或者 _斜体字_
    斜体字


    **粗体** 或者 __粗体__
    粗体


    ***粗斜体*** 或者 ___粗斜体___
    粗斜体


    上标:X<sub>2</sub>,下标O<sup>2</sup>
    x2, O2


    缩写
    The <abbr title="Hyper Text Markup Language">HTML<abbr/> specification is maintained by the <abbr title="World Wide Web Consortium">W3C</abbr>
    The HTML specification is maintained by the W3C


    引用

    >这里是引用

    这里是引用


    嵌套

    > 最外层
    >> 第一层嵌套
    >>> 第三层
    

    最外层

    第一层嵌套

    第三层


    超链接

    普通连接

    [Markdown官网](https://www.mdeditor.com/)
    

    Markdown官网


    直接连接

    直接连接:<https://www.mdeditor.com>
    

    直接连接:https://www.mdeditor.com

    邮箱地址自动连接


    代码高亮

    行内代码
    执行命令: `npm install marked`
    执行命令:npm install marked

    说明: (` `) 反引号用来显示行内代码,只能显示一行,如果是多行,它会自动合并成一行显示,要显示多行代码需要用(三反引号```开头),(三反引号```结尾),如果要显示反引号,用双反引号引起来,这是`反引号`


    多行代码
    显示多行代码需要用(三反引号```开头),(三反引号```结尾)
    python代码

    def func():
        lists=['a','b']
        for li in lists:
            print(li)
    

    PHP代码

    <?php
        echo "hello world!";
    ?>
    

    JS代码

    function test(){
        console.log("hello world!");
    }
    

    HTML代码

    <!DOCTYPE html>
    <html>
        <head>
            <mate charest="utf-8" />
            <meta name="keywords" content="Editor.md, Markdown, Editor" />
            <title>Hello world!</title>
            <style type="text/css">
                body{font-size:14px;color:#444;font-family: "Microsoft Yahei", Tahoma, "Hiragino Sans GB", Arial;background:#fff;}
                ul{list-style: none;}
                img{border:none;vertical-align: middle;}
            </style>
        </head>
        <body>
            <h1 class="text-xxl">Hello world!</h1>
            <p class="text-green">Plain text</p>
        </body>
    </html>
    


    预格式化文本

    缩进四个空格,也作为实现类似<pre>预格式化文本的功能

    | first header | second header |
    | ------------ | ------------- |
    |     cell     |      cell     |
    |     cell     |      cell     |
    


    图片

    图片加链接

    [![](https://www.mdeditor.com/images/logos/markdown.png)](https://www.mdeditor.com/images/logos/markdown.png "markdown")
    


    列表

    无序列表(减号或者星号)
    示例:

    - 列表一
    - 列表二
    * 列表三
    * 列表四
    

    效果:

    • 列表一
    • 列表二
    • 列表三
    • 列表四


    列表嵌套(加号)
    示例:

    + 列表一
    + 列表二
        + 列表二(1)
        + 列表二(2)
    + 列表三
        * 列表三(1)
        * 列表三(2)
    

    效果:

    • 列表一
    • 列表二
      • 列表二(1)
      • 列表二(2)
    • 列表三
      • 列表三(1)
      • 列表三(2)


    有序列表
    示例:

    1. 第一行
    2. 第二行
    3. 第三行
    

    效果:

    1. 第一行
    2. 第二行
    3. 第三行


    绘制表格
    示例:

    |  项目  |  价格   |  数量   |
    | :----: | :----: | :----:  |
    | 计算机 |   1600  |   12   |
    |  手机  |   600   |   23   |
    

    效果:

    项目 价格 数量
    计算机 1600 12
    手机 600 23


    如何设置表格对齐方式

    格式 含义
    :---- 左对齐
    ----: 右对齐
    :----: 中间对齐

    先写到这儿,以后有需要再进行补充.

  • 相关阅读:
    链表
    std::map
    linux配置永久ip不生效解决方法
    linux命令英文缩写的含义(方便记忆)
    互联网创业其实就这24种商业模式
    当用反射获取一个model,这个model里面字段有nullable的时候,获取字段真实类型
    自定义alert和confirm
    web上传大文件的配置
    windows服务-log4net的使用
    vs中的各种快捷键
  • 原文地址:https://www.cnblogs.com/leerep/p/12060690.html
Copyright © 2020-2023  润新知